Weeping Tile Repair in Providence, RI
Weeping tile repair services focus on maintaining the integrity of a property's drainage system designed to prevent basement flooding and water damage. This service typically addresses issues such as cracked, clogged, or displaced weeping tiles, which can lead to improper water flow and potential structural concerns. Property owners often request this work when noticing signs of excess moisture, water pooling around foundations, or basement dampness, aiming to restore proper drainage and protect the property’s foundation.
Before requesting weeping tile repair, homeowners should understand the scope of the existing drainage system and any underlying issues that may have caused damage or blockages. It’s helpful to know the location of the affected areas, whether there are visible signs of water intrusion, and if previous repairs have been attempted. This information assists in planning an effective repair approach to ensure proper water management and long-term stability of the property.

Weeping Tile Repair Questions
What is weeping tile repair? It involves fixing or replacing the drainage system around a foundation to prevent water from seeping into the basement.
When is weeping tile repair needed? Repairs are needed if there are signs of basement flooding, persistent dampness, or visible damage around the foundation.
What are common signs of damaged weeping tile? Signs include water pooling near the foundation, musty odors, or increased humidity inside the basement.
How does weeping tile repair benefit a property? Proper repair helps protect the foundation, reduces water intrusion, and maintains a dry, stable basement environment.
